Tariff Notice No. 1984/202—Applications for Withdrawal of Determinations
NOTICE is hereby given that applications have been made for the withdrawal of the following determinations of the Minister of Customs and for the future admission of the goods at substantive rates of duty:
| Port | Appn. No. | Tariff Item No. | Goods | Rates of Duty | Part II Ref. | Concession Code | Effective |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Normal | Pref. | From | To* | |||||
| H.O. 65661 | 84.45.001 | Bar, tube, rod and profile bending machines NOT exceeding the following capacities; bar; 60.3mm×8mm tube; 150 mm rod; 22.22 mm | 40 | Aul 10 Can 25 DC 25 Pac Free | 207827K | 1/84 | 12/84 | |
| H.O. 65661 | 84.45.001 | Machinery, peculiar for use in making and repairing exhaust systems and other products made from metal tubing, not exceeding the following capacity; swaging, 19 mm—76 mm; expanding, 25 mm—76 mm; bending, 19 mm—76 mm; and forming bends of 60 mm—140 mm radi EXCLUDING: Numerically controlled machine tools | 40 | Aul 10 Can 25 DC 25 Pac Free | 207855E | 1/84 | 12/84 |
Any person wishing to lodge an objection to the granting of this application should do so in writing on or before 25 October 1984. Submissions should include a reference to the application number, Tariff item and description of goods concerned, and be addressed to the Comptroller of Customs, Private Bag, Wellington, and supported by information as to:
(a) The quality, range, supply, etc., of the above-described goods produced in New Zealand; and
(b) The landed cost and selling price, including c.d.v., and cost into store in terms of f.o.b., insurance, freight, exchange, other landing charges, duty, etc., of equivalent goods of overseas origin.
Dated at Wellington this 4th day of October 1984.
P. J. McKONE, Comptroller of Customs.
Notice Under the Regulations Act 1936
PURSUANT to the Regulations Act 1936, notice is hereby given of the making of regulations as under:
| Authority for Enactment | Title or Subject-matter | Serial Number | Date of Enactment | Cash Price | Postage and Packaging |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Social Security Act 1964 | Social Security (Dental Benefits) Regulations 1983, Amendment No. 1 | 1984/245 | 1/10/84 | 40c | 75c |
| Gas Act 1982 | Gas Industry Regulations 1984 | 1984/246 | 1/10/84 | 80c | $1.15 |
